DTF Gangsheet Builder for High-Volume Production: Maximize Print Production Efficiency

In high-volume DTF printing operations, a DTF Gangsheet Builder translates automation into tangible gains in print production efficiency. By automatically tiling designs on the gangsheet, managing bleed and gutter spaces, and applying color management presets, it reduces setup time per sheet and minimizes human error in DTF printing workflows. The result is faster throughput, more consistent colors, and a scalable workflow across shifts—especially when integrated with your DTF software and compatible RIPs.

Key features drive ROI for shops with catalogs or frequent small runs: automated tiling, preflight checks, and export-ready files that align with printer capabilities and media margins, ensuring reliable gangsheet layout across batches. Start with standardized templates, calibrate color profiles, and run pilot proofs to quantify gains in print production efficiency before expanding usage.

Manual Layout vs DTF Gangsheet Builder: When Flexibility and Creative Control Still Matter

Manual layout remains valuable when designs are irregular or require bespoke placements, enabling designers to optimize for aesthetics, fabric characteristics, or unusual garment shapes. If you already own design tools and want to avoid extra licenses, manual layout can be a cost-effective option in the short term, especially for low-volume runs and highly creative projects.

However, the trade-offs are clear: slower throughput per sheet, higher risk of human error, and potential inconsistency across operators. A hybrid workflow—using automation for the bulk of standard layouts while reserving manual adjustments for exceptional designs—can balance creative freedom with operational efficiency in both DTF printing and general gangsheet layout processes, helping you maintain quality without sacrificing flexibility as volumes grow.

Frequently Asked Questions

DTF Gangsheet Builder vs Manual Layout: When should I use each approach in DTF printing?

DTF Gangsheet Builder automates gangsheet layout tasks (tiling, bleed, gutters, color management) within DTF software to maximize speed, consistency, and production efficiency. Manual layout offers maximum flexibility for irregular shapes or unique placements but is slower and more error-prone. For high-volume, standardized orders, automation tends to win; for custom or complex designs, manual layout may be preferable. A hybrid workflow often delivers the best balance between efficiency and creative control.

How does a DTF Gangsheet Builder improve print production efficiency in DTF printing?

Using DTF Gangsheet Builder (DTF software) with a gangsheet layout streamlines setup, reduces waste, and ensures repeatable results. Automation handles tiling, margins, color profiles, and preflight checks, cutting setup time and human error. This leads to faster turnarounds, more consistent outputs across runs, and easier scaling across shifts compared with manual layout.

Workflow Tips
  • Define standardized templates for common sizes and garment types
  • Calibrate color with standardized profiles and checks
  • Preflight everything to catch missing art, low-res images, or out-of-bounds colors
  • Run pilot tests to verify placement and color accuracy
  • Track waste and efficiency to optimize tiling and margins
  • Maintain organized design libraries and clear version control
  • Invest in training so operators maximize tool features

Quality Control Considerations
  • Preflight sheet: Confirm presence, size, and alignment
  • Color verification: Compare proofs to final prints under consistent lighting
  • Mechanical checks: Inspect gutter width, bleed, and margins
  • Post-print review: Check placement accuracy and color fidelity
